Hello all! I was just reading posts in a Facebook group I am a part of, and one lady posted about losing her hair. It had tons of comments from people saying they all lost hair, too. Is this something to expect? My surgery is scheduled for December 23 and I already have very thin hair, so I'm kind of worried.

Most people start losing hair 3 or 4 months out. It is due to the stress of the surgery and the fact that we are basically starving the first few weeks out. Some people say getting all your Protein in helps but many do everything right and still lose hair. It does grow back.

I lost a significant amount of hair. Biotin won't prevent it but could help once your hair is ready to regrow. My hair texture changed a lot as well. My nut says that hair follicles in the resting stage will shed around 4 months, which is exactly when it happened for me. I lost hair for about six weeks and now have curly hair.
